Apartment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minor Leaks | Yes | No | You can fix minor leaks with a DIY approach, but ensure you follow all safety protocols and take necessary precautions. |
| Major Floods | No | Yes | Major floods need spec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ively. Don’t risk your health and property by trying to tackle it alone. |
| Hidden Moisture or Mold | No | Yes | Hidden moisture or mold can be a serious health hazard. Our technicians are trained to detect and remove these issues, ensuring your safety and property. |
| Structural Damage | No | Yes | Structural damage needs specialized expertise to assess and repair safely. Don’t risk further damage by trying to fix it yourself. |
While some situations may seem manageable with a DIY approach, it’s essential to consider the potential risks and consequences. Apartment Water Damage Restoration Cost in Wilson, PA
The cost of Apartment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ect to pay: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s |
| Debris Removal and Cleaning |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s |
| Disinfection and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s |
